The correct answer is Indravati

Key Points:

  • The Godavari river is the largest river system in Peninsular India.
  • The Godavari basin extends over the States of Maharashtra, Andhra Pradesh, Chhattisgarh, and Odisha in addition to smaller parts in Madhya Pradesh, Karnataka, and Puducherry (Yanam).
  • The other names for the Godavari River are The Vriddh (Old) Ganga or the Dakshin (South) Ganga.
  • Godavari river drains into the Bay of Bengal.
  • Godavari river originates from Bramhagiri mountains at Trimbakeshwar.
  • Tributaries: Pravara, Purna, Manjira, Penganga, Wardha, Wainganga, Pranhita (combined flow of Wainganga, Penganga, Wardha), Indravati, Maner, and the Sabri.
  • The longest tributary- The Manjira
  • The largest tributary- The Pranhita

Additional Information Chambal:

  • The Chambal river originates in Manpura near Indore in Madhya Pradesh.
  • The length of the river is 900 km and it is a tributary of the Yamuna river.
  • The Chambal River remains one of North India’s unpolluted rivers, home to a rich diversity of flora and fauna.
  • The National Chambal Gharial Wildlife Sanctuary is famous for the rare Ganges river dolphin.
  • Apart from the Ganges river dolphin, the other inhabitants of the sanctuary include magar (crocodile) and gharial (alligator). Migratory birds from Siberia form part of its rich avian fauna.

Banas:

  • Banas river originates from Khamnor Hills of the Aravalli Range, near Kumbhalgarh in Rajsamand, Rajasthan.  '
  • Banas river is a tributary of the Chambal River and ii is approximately 512 kilometers in length.
  • This river is also called ‘Van Ki Asha‘.
  •  There is another river in Rajasthan with name of Banas.
  • The Banas river entirely flows within the Rajasthan in:-
    •  Ajmer, Bhilwara, Bundi, Chittorgarh, Dausa, Jaipur, Pali, Rajsamand, Sawai Madhopur, Sirohi, Tonk, and Udaipur districts of Rajasthan. 
  • It flows northeast through the Mewar region of Rajasthan and meets the Chambal near the village of Rameshwar in Sawai Madhopur district.

Tawa:

  • Tawa River is the tributary of the Narmada River.
  • It is the longest tributary of the Narmada River.
  • Its origin is in the Satpura range.
  • It meets the Narmada at Hoshangabad district.
  • Its length is 172 km.
